Black Walnut Tree Blossoms: A Guide to Identifying, Harvesting, and Using Nature's Unique Forage

The black walnut tree blossoms emerge in late spring, adorning the branches with a subtle, aromatic display that often goes unnoticed beneath the canopy of mature foliage. These delicate structures are the precursors to the prized nuts, signaling the beginning of a seasonal cycle that enthusiasts and foragers eagerly anticipate. Understanding the nuances of these blossoms is essential for anyone interested in the tree’s ecology, harvest, or culinary potential.

Identifying the Blossoms

Distinguishing between the male and female flowers is the first step in observing the black walnut’s reproductive process. The male catkins are long, slender, and pendulous, releasing a cloud of yellow pollen into the air. In contrast, the female flowers are small, round, and feature a distinctive pinkish-green stigma, resembling tiny rosettes positioned close to the branches.

Male Catkins

Appearing in clusters, the male catkins hang down and sway gently in the breeze. Their presence is often the first visible sign of the tree’s awakening for the season. The pollen they release is lightweight and can be carried by the wind to nearby female flowers for successful fertilization.

Female Flowers

The female blossoms are less conspicuous but play the crucial role of fruit development. They are typically found at the tips of new shoots and require successful pollination to develop into the familiar hard-shelled nuts. The transition from flower to fruit is a slow process that unfolds over the summer months.

Seasonal Timing and Environmental Factors

The timing of the black walnut tree blossoms is heavily influenced by climate and geographic location. In most regions, the male catkins appear before the female flowers, a mechanism that reduces the chance of self-pollination. Cool temperatures and damp conditions during the blooming period can significantly impact the success rate of fruit set.

The Role in the Ecosystem

Beyond their role in nut production, the blossoms contribute to the biodiversity of their surroundings. They provide an early source of pollen for emerging pollinators, such as bees, which are crucial for the health of the local ecosystem. The tree’s allelopathic properties, while beneficial for weed suppression, also mean that few plants grow beneath the drip line, making the floral display a vital interaction point for insects.

Harvesting Considerations

For those who cultivate black walnuts, the blossoms serve as a critical indicator for timing management practices. While the flowers themselves are not harvested, their successful pollination determines the yield of the crop. Orchard managers often monitor the bloom to predict the density of the upcoming harvest and plan cultural practices accordingly.
